I need to create automatic Microsoft Office installation for 10 users. How to do it?

Create a regular automatic installation package. When you are prompted to enter the product key, place the cursor on the first field of the key and click the ‘Pause’ button on the MultiSet record panel. Enter the first part of the five-digit key in the dialog box. Click the ‘Insert’ button. Place the cursor into the second field of the key and repeat your actions. Do the same for all other parts of the key. After you install MS Office, click the ‘Stop’ button on the MultiSet record panel. The automatic installation package is ready. Now copy the package 9 times using Drag&Drop or holding down the Ctrl key. As a result, you will get 10 packages. Specify the corresponding key on the ‘Inserts’ tab in the properties of each package.
